Gabriel Lizama Sangüeza AKA Liz Taylor (Santiago de Chile, 1990) is a Chilean artist and academic who has dedicated himself to: music, cinema, film criticism, research, photography and audiovisual teaching. Since 2010 he has created short experimental, fiction and documentary films, music videos and audiovisual research. He is a member of the Film-maker's Cooperative (NYC, USA).

After a 10-year hiatus from making short films, in 2024 he returned with his saga (still in development) "Chilean Chants", short films that explore various traumas and events related to the fragmented identity of Chile, through the moving image and its eternal dance with time.

Some of his films have reached festivals and markets in the U.S., France and Chile. He's the coordinator and programmer in the Sala Sazie Cine Club of the University of Chile, the oldest and most prestigious in the country.
